Product Overview & Official Specifications
The kit includes a sturdy ABS base, a built‑in ruler, and a set of four interchangeable pins that snap onto the joist for a repeatable reference point. It is designed to be fastened directly to ceiling joists with either a staple gun, a nail, or a screw, providing a stable platform for marking speaker cut‑outs before drywall goes up.
| Specification | Detail |
|---|---|
| Material | High‑impact ABS plastic |
| Weight | 0.8 lb (360 g) |
| Dimensions | 6.5″ × 3.2″ × 1.5″ (165 mm × 81 mm × 38 mm) |
| Attachment Methods | Staples, nails, or screws |
| Compatibility | Backbox BB6C, standard 6‑inch in‑ceiling speakers |
| Included Items | 1 × Base plate, 4 × Pin guides, 1 × Instruction sheet |
| Warranty | 1‑year limited |
| Price | $29.40 |

Real-World Performance & In-Depth Feature Analysis
Build Quality & Material Performance
The ABS housing felt solid in hand – a slight flex was noticeable only when applying excessive force. During a 6‑month field test on a residential remodel, the kit endured repeated hammering of nails without cracking, confirming its resistance to typical construction impacts.
Daily Operation & Performance
Marking a speaker location involves snapping a pin into the joist, aligning the guide ruler, and scoring the drywall cut‑out. The process consistently produced cuts within ±2 mm of the intended centerline, well inside the industry tolerance of ±5 mm for in‑ceiling speakers.
Setup Experience & Compatibility
Installation is straightforward: drive a staple or screw through the pre‑drilled holes, snap the pins, and you have a permanent reference. The kit works on both wooden and metal joists, but metal joists required a self‑tapping screw for a secure grip. Compatibility with the BB6C backbox was seamless – the pins line up perfectly with the backbox mounting holes.
Long-Term Durability & Reliability
After 150 installation cycles across three separate jobs, the pins showed no wear and the base remained firmly attached. The ABS surface showed no discoloration despite exposure to drywall dust and occasional splashes of water.
